I would like to use the GPU hardware-accelerated in chrome browser( Ubuntu 14.0.4).
However, it does not seem to work.

Typing "chrome://gpu/" in Chrome, displays the following.
========================================================
Graphics Feature Status
Canvas: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Flash: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Flash Stage3D: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Flash Stage3D Baseline profile: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Compositing: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Multiple Raster Threads: Disabled
Rasterization: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Threaded Rasterization: Unavailable
Video Decode: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
Video Encode: Software only, hardware acceleration unavailable
WebGL: Unavailable
=====================================================

I tried to get hardware acceleration in Chrome.

1.Search for "hardware" and tick the checkbox for "Use hardware acceleration..." in chrome://settings
2.Enable "Override software rendering list" in chrome://flags/

The result is the same as before.
